Common Grackle

Quiscalus quiscula

Description:

Males are black with and bright metallic blue head. Females are brown.

Habitat:

Cities, Towns

Notes:

Likes to eat peanuts

Great, but this is a Common. Boat-tailed have a much larger head, the Commons is fairly narrow. Also, Boat-tailed have a giant tail which this bird does not have.
